Handover note — Crumbwheel order cutoffs.

Welcome aboard. The bakery cutoff rule in Crumbwheel closes same-day orders at 14:00 local to each storefront, not UTC — this has bitten us twice. Holiday overrides live in the calendar service and take precedence silently, so always check there first when a cutoff looks wrong. To unlock the calendar service's admin console after a restart, enter the recovery passphrase below.

vault phrase of bagap-bahaf = silion-pelox-sorox-casdor-quenwyn-fraax-eliox-praael-kelion-quenvan-kasox-rusael-norius-belvan

Ticket: Staging env misconfigured for Siftgate bloom filter

The bloom layer in front of the Pellet KV store is rejecting all lookups in staging because the env file was copied from the dev template without credentials. False-positive tuning values are fine; only the auth line is missing. To unblock the weekly demo, the Pellet admission secret must be set on the following line.

env line for yaguf-fajop: LEDGER_TOKEN13=fb08984397349

For branch managers ahead of Thursday's review.

Quick version: we're adding a Summit tier above Crestline Pro, bundling priority support, the Averock analytics pack, and quarterly strategy sessions. Pricing lands roughly 40% above Pro, aimed at our top two hundred accounts. Pilot branches in Dellworth and Fanshawe start next month; everyone else follows after we sort onboarding capacity. Please don't pre-announce to customers yet. The commercial thinking behind the launch is set out in the note below.

board note of bawep-tajef: Queniusek Systems plans to raise the Quenvan list price by 53.1 percent in March. The pricing group signed off on a budget of $176.4 million for Project Drueth. The renewal with Casionix Partners closes at $142.5 million a year, 8.3 percent below the last contract. Project Fraax slips by six weeks because of the tooling delay.

Welcome to the Keyhollow squad! One project you'll hear about at the weekly sync is the password reset flow revamp. Short version: we're replacing the old emailed-token flow with short-lived reset links plus a rate limiter, because the legacy flow let expired tokens be replayed within a five-minute window. The rollout is behind the resetflow-v2 flag, currently at 20% of traffic. Dashboards live in the Keyhollow board. If you spot reset anomalies or have rollout questions, write to the address below.

escalation mailbox, bafog-fafog: ulador@paliqlabs.internal